Shoes For Athletes: How To Spot Performance-Driven Footwear For Sports & Fitness

When participating in sports and fitness activities, having the appropriate footwear is one of the most important things you can have to perform at your peak. If you don't wear the proper footwear, sports and fitness-related activities can be difficult. The appropriate footwear is crucial to maintaining the health of your feet, in addition to the importance of sports and fitness for overall body wellness. The incorrect footwear choice might result in immediate harm or damage that may take time to manifest.

You should be aware of the many aspects to consider and their sorts when purchasing new shoes. Learn how to select the ideal footwear in this article to keep your feet safe.

Factors to Consider While Buying Sports Shoes

To make sure you have the ideal shoes for your needs, it's necessary to take a few variables into account when purchasing sports and fitness gear. As follows:

Type of Activity

What kind of activity you plan to wear the shoes for should be your first consideration while picking footwear. Use several pairs of shoes for different activities. Running, walking, jumping, and lifting weights can all be supported by various types of footwear. While some shoes are better at giving surface traction, others are better at offering cushioning. The first step to having happy feet is understanding what activity you intend to engage in while wearing footwear.

Size and Shape of the Feet

Everybody is unique, just like every foot is. What works for one individual won't necessarily work for another. There are persons with wide feet, narrow feet, high arches, low arches, pronated feet, supinated feet, and so forth. Always make sure the pair of shoes you chose fits your feet's measurements and qualities before making a purchase.

Quality and Durability

Athletic and fitness footwear purchases can be pricey. Make sure the shoes you buy are worth the money you are paying. A decent pair of shoes should be composed of sturdy materials, be well-crafted, and last for a long time. They ought to be able to withstand all the strain and shock of physical activity and last their entire lives unharmed. When purchasing high-quality, long-lasting shoes, you won't need to buy another pair for a while.

Types of Sports and Fitness Footwear

Here are a few of the most well-liked sports and fitness footwear categories:

Rock Climbing Shoes

An adventurous sport that is not for the timid is rock climbing. At tremendous heights, even a tiny error might have disastrous results. To increase your chances of success while climbing mountains, you should use rock climbing footwear. These shoes are made to be cozy and secure on rocky mountain terrain. Additionally, they have small, pointed toes that can easily slide between cracks and provide you with leverage as you ascend. If you want to climb a rock or a mountain, choose this option.

Tennis needs a lot of abrupt stops, starts, and side-to-side motions. The continual switching from one side of the court to the other makes it a physically taxing sport. If you participate in such a strenuous activity while wearing the incorrect footwear, your feet could easily suffer damage. Tennis shoes are typically light and have flat soles that offer great traction on court surfaces and allow for easy mobility while safeguarding your feet. If you wish to play tennis, squash, or badminton, you should use these shoes.

Walking Shoes

Walking shoes are typically breathable, flexible, and light to allow your feet to roll from heel to toe. You may move with ease and comfort on flat surfaces for extended periods of time without harming your feet thanks to this rolling action. The best uses for these shoes are for daily usage and low-intensity activities like hiking and walking.

Basketball Sneakers

Basketball shoes are expertly designed to withstand high-impact sports like running, jumping, and landing on hard, flat surfaces. Their interior cushioning safeguards your foot from harm while the robust outside sole offers stability and traction. Additionally, they include high-top styles that offer excellent ankle support and are ideal for preventing injuries. It is a delight to wear these stylish sneakers when watching basketball, volleyball, or netball games.
